Spatial distribution pattern of main tree species in Pinus tabulae formis forest of Heilihe in Inner-Mongolia.

Yun Zhang, Chunyu Zhang, Zhao XiuHai

Open publisher page 3 citations

Abstract

A Pinus tabulaeformis forest which was established in Heilihe natural reserve of Inner Mongolia at the area of 1.96 hm2 were investigated by sampling methods.Tree composition and DBH structure of P.tabulaeformis forest were analyzed.Spatial pattern of main tree species in arbor layer and spatial distribution of P.tabulaeformis population on different growth stages(saplings,small trees and big trees) were analyzed by Ripley's K function.The results indicated that there were 13 tree species in arbor layer,and P.tabulaeformis was dominant species accompanied with Acer mono,Quercus mongolica,Tilia mongolica,Populus davidiana,Betula platyphylla as main concomitance species.DBH distribution of main tree species in P.tabulaeformis forest presented inverse J shape and showed some characters of natural forest.In spatial pattern,main tree species showed an aggregated distribution in the forest,among them,P.tabulaeformis showed an aggregated distribution at scale of 1~65 m and random distribution at scale of 65~70 m,other main tree species showed an aggregated distribution at all scales.Spatial pattern of P.tabulaeformis population tended to be random distribution with population growth(from saplings to small trees to big trees).
